解决themoviedb被DNS污染导致群晖Emby服务器和TMM无法刮削电影的问题
是返乡过年?还是就地过年?最新一届#双面过节指南#开始啦!本次征稿活动分为A面返乡和B面就地,大家可以根据自己的情况,分享自己的春节攻略,优秀的投稿文章还有可能能获得优厚的大奖哦,快点击查看活动详情<<<
【写作说明】:感谢张大妈里面的大神,教会了我买蜗牛星际,组NAS,装黑群晖,最重要的就是在群晖里面安装好Emby服务器,在电视中安装KODI,并装好Emby插件后,完美播放NAS下载的电影,效果非常地好,画美很漂亮,电影信息刮削也是又快又准。但是,因为themoviedb被DNS污染了,所以近来几天,群晖Emby服务器和TMM都无法刮削电影信息,所以本文就是来教大家通过修改hosts文件的方式来让群晖Emby服务器可以访问themoviedb使其可以继续刮削电影信息。
如果大家不知道如何使用KODI,并装好Emby插件后,完美播放NAS下载的电影,可以参考下面这篇文章。
下面是正文:
1、打开SHH并通过SHH获得ROOT权限:
打开SHH端口后,用PUTTY登录群晖,登录后运行sudo -i 命令切换到root权限
2、ROOT后,打开群晖的hosts文件,输入下面代码
vi /etc/hosts
(注意vi后面有一个空格)
按a键进入编辑模式(下面显示--INSERT--),再修改内容
重点来了:
去到下面的空行,输入以下命令:
13.224.161.90 api.themoviedb.org
修改完成后保存hosts文件并退出
ECS键盘(退出编辑模式),再连续按两次大写的ZZ
至此,修改hosts文件完成,你的EMBY已经可以刮削电影信息了。
测试一下,在没有修改前,EMBY服务器中的电影是这样的:
即使是手动识别,也是无法搜到信息。通过修改hosts文件后,已经可以找到相关电影:
又可以完美地刮削电影信息了
总结
win电脑使用TMM刮削电影信息的,原理也是一样,只是hosts文件是存在C:WindowsSystem32driversetchosts,使用记事本打开,然后加入上面那条信息,保存就可以了。
谢谢大家。

也是用的Openwrt,酸酸乳把这两个域名加入强制走代理就可以githubusercontent.com、themoviedb.org
大佬用的啥软路由啊。我这Openwrt不行了。所有外网都能打开。就是这个搜刮不了。
软路由里把这两个域名加入强制走代理,一劳永逸
请问下我打不开插件目录有办法吗
看完本文应该会了吧
侧重问一下,这段神秘代码应该怎么用呢?
嗯 解决了 删除原先的 然后再添加就好了 谢谢回复
试试条码加入到路由器中
你好 以前按你的方法做了 没问题 这几天自己手贱emby 重新删掉 又安装后 就无法搜刮海报 但进去看那个条码还在 真的不知道怎么弄了 求大神指教
大神,我照你的方法,改好了群晖的hosts,但为啥还是连不上啊。现在在ssh中用ping能ping通api.themoviedb.org了。但是在Emby里还是刷不出来。怎么回事呢?
额,直接改下路由不是更简单!?
api.themoviedb.org的ip地址经常会换,如果发现不能用就去查询,改一下host或者DNS反向代理
确实如此,只是旧款路由器没有改host功能
你是不是改了群晖的dns啊
我也是这样操作的。懒得改群晖。
没有root。
后来我直接修改了路由器的host文件,解决了,比改nas的简单多了,而且同时解决了电脑端的问题
需要root下修改吧.sudo -i .
教大伙怎么选自己最快的IP,百度站长工具,然后国际ping api.themoviedb.org 出结果了选延迟最低的IP改
应该是你输错了,我刚刚又测试了一次,网址没有问题
楼主,请教下输完地址后显示-ash: 104.16.61.155: command not found,怎么办
163.172.219.181 assets.fanart.tv
35.185.44.232 tinymediamanager.gitlab.io
104.16.57.155 image.tmdb.org
104.16.61.155 image.tmdb.org
加上这几个试试 可能会好一些
可用 点赞~!
这个好啊,支持,点赞
演员信息还不行呀
电视剧没试过,只知道电影是可以的
添加了thetvdb的dns,kodi还是无法连接远程服务器,是不是不行?thetvdb插件是3.2.4
Unraid下我也参照这方法弄了,plex服务端终于可以比较流畅识别电影并刮削到海报了,哈哈
还真没遇到过,百度一下
请教,我在修改hosts文件时,提示 E45:‘readonly’ option is set(add ! to override),这如何解决